• <ins id="pjuwb"></ins>
    <blockquote id="pjuwb"><pre id="pjuwb"></pre></blockquote>
    <noscript id="pjuwb"></noscript>
          <sup id="pjuwb"><pre id="pjuwb"></pre></sup>
            <dd id="pjuwb"></dd>
            <abbr id="pjuwb"></abbr>

            牽著老婆滿街逛

            嚴以律己,寬以待人. 三思而后行.
            GMail/GTalk: yanglinbo#google.com;
            MSN/Email: tx7do#yahoo.com.cn;
            QQ: 3 0 3 3 9 6 9 2 0 .

            YUV Formats

            轉載自:http://blog.csdn.net/jerrytong/article/details/5655439

            YUV Color Space

            Color is decomposed in three components.

                  Y: represents Luminance. 
                  U (Cb): is the Chroma channel, U axis, blue component.
                  V (Cr): is the Chroma channel, V axis, red component.

            The first reason to use the YUV decomposition is that a conversion of an RGB signal (such as the one used on computer monitors) to YUV requires just a linear transform, which is really easy to do with analogue circuitry and it is cheap to compute numerically.

            The second reason that YUV allows separating the color information from the luminance component (which we perceive as brightness). For this reason YUV is used worldwide for television and motion picture encoding standards such as PAL, SECAM and for JPEG/MPEG compression. Since the human eye is also much more responsive to luminance, JPEG compresses more heavily the chroma channels which are less likely to cause perceptible differences in the resulting image.

             

            There are several YUV formats. There are interleaved formats and planar formats (also called packed formats). The main difference is how they are stored in memory.

            Interleaved images have all color components needed to represent a pixel placed at the same place in memory. For planar formats the data is not interleaved, but stored separately for each color channel (also called color plane).

            For filter writers this means that they can write one simple function that is called three times, one for each color channel, assuming that the operations are channel-independent (which is not always the case). Again, using aligned for both color and luma channels will allow easy memory access. The use of a planar format gives in most cases a significant speedup, since all bytes of each plane can be treated the same way. It can also give a speedup because your filter doesn't have to work on all planes, if it only modifies one or two of them.

             

            4:4:4 Format (Base YUV Format)

             

             

            In this format size of matrices of Y, U and V value are as same as RGB.

            Image size: 176x144.
            RGB: 3 matrices in size of 176x144.
            YUV: 3 matrices in size of 176x144.

             

            4:2:2 Format (Known as YUY2)

            However in 4:2:2 format Y value is 176x144 but U and V values are half sizes, 88x72.

            Image size: 176x144.
            RGB: 3 matrices in size of 176x144.
                 Y: 176x144.
                 U: 88x72.
                 V: 88x72.

             

            YUY2 colorformat

            YUY2 is an interleaved image format. Bytes are arranged in memory like this:

            YUYV|YUYV|YUYV|YUYV|YUYV|YUYV|...
            ^first byte in a row.
            

             

             

            So when converting back to RGB color space each U and V value is used four times to complete the conversion. Figure 1 shows the usage of the 4:2:2 format while converting back to RGB.

            Figure 1. YUV 4:2:2 format.

             


            posted on 2013-01-25 12:06 楊粼波 閱讀(422) 評論(0)  編輯 收藏 引用

            久久精品不卡| 久久午夜夜伦鲁鲁片免费无码影视 | 国产成人无码精品久久久久免费| 久久精品国产一区二区三区日韩| 久久精品中文字幕无码绿巨人| 99久久国产综合精品网成人影院| 久久久久久久综合日本| 久久天天躁狠狠躁夜夜网站| 国产成人精品久久亚洲高清不卡 | 亚洲国产成人乱码精品女人久久久不卡 | 国产精品久久久久影视不卡| 久久一区二区三区99| 久久棈精品久久久久久噜噜| 狠狠色伊人久久精品综合网 | 久久人妻少妇嫩草AV蜜桃| 日本人妻丰满熟妇久久久久久| 色偷偷888欧美精品久久久| 亚洲精品乱码久久久久久久久久久久| 精品亚洲综合久久中文字幕| 久久综合亚洲鲁鲁五月天| 九九久久精品无码专区| 精品久久一区二区三区| 久久99国产乱子伦精品免费| 中文成人无码精品久久久不卡| 免费国产99久久久香蕉| 996久久国产精品线观看| 亚洲日本va午夜中文字幕久久 | 91精品国产91久久| 99久久精品国内| av无码久久久久久不卡网站| 亚洲AV无码1区2区久久| 久久婷婷人人澡人人爽人人爱 | 国色天香久久久久久久小说| 午夜视频久久久久一区 | 少妇精品久久久一区二区三区| 欧美性大战久久久久久| 久久婷婷人人澡人人| 久久精品成人免费国产片小草| 国产精品久久久久乳精品爆| 国产成人久久777777| 久久久久国产一区二区三区|